Title: Social Enterprises from the Perspective of Political Economy: Time Attribute, Possible Path and Development Prospect

Keywords (5 keywords maximum) Social enterprise; political economy; economic and social transformation; governance; innovation

Related Conference Theme: Social Enterprise

Abstract (between 500 and 800 words in length, excluding bibliography): Under the background of 's social and economic transformation, especially under the policy of structural reform, the social and economic vitality has been stimulated, and the virtuous relationship between the government and the market has been raised again. The diversification of the economic field is in full swing. As a manifestation of the diversification of modern production relations, social enterprise is a new corporate governance structure and a new production relationship. It is a new economic growth point and a reflection and practice of new development thinking. The social enterprise not only conforms to the overall law of economic operation, but also can promote the multi-level goal of economic development, and based on its own characteristics and external factors of multi-support, its regularity and purpose of the unity of the actual conditions have been basically available. It can be seen that social enterprises are not only a new economic phenomenon, it will also lead to a world from the concept to the practice of economic change boom. In China, social enterprises in the history and cultural heritage, development ideas, practical experience, theoretical research, economic promotion and so have special significance. The development of Chinese social enterprises should not only learn from international experience, but also pay attention to the development of Chinese local cultural traditions and economic resources. In the long run, the social enterprises will be escalated with the transformation of social governance and the improvement of the system ecology, which will play a link role in the construction of enterprises and social ecology circle, and promote the superposition and enlargement of the positive effect of social influence.
